The development of hydro generation requires planning permission from the relevant planning authority in accordance with the provisions of the Planning Acts, having due regard to other relevant legal frameworks and guidelines. The principal legislation governing the protection of fish in the development of hydro generation is set out in Part 8, Chapter 5 of the Fisheries (Consolidation) Act 1959, as amended. Consideration must also be given to the protection of fisheries afforded by the Water Framework Directive, the Habitats Directive and other relevant EU legislation. Finally, my Department and the then Fisheries Boards (now Inland Fisheries Ireland) released a report in October 2007 entitled "Guidelines on the Construction and Operation of Small Scale Hydro Electric Schemes and Fisheries" which can be downloaded from the Inland Fisheries Ireland website at www.fisheriesireland.ie.
